Your browser does not support javascript! Please enable it, otherwise web will not work for you.

Corporate Communications Specialist @ RGBSI

Home > Corporate Communication

 Corporate Communications Specialist

Job Description

Title: Corporate Communications Specialist


Service description: Member of the India corporate communications team.


Responsibilities- As a Corporate Communications Specialist, you will play a critical role in executing strategic programs that span multiple communications channels and formats and advance brand and reputation goals internally and externally. In this role, you will be responsible for developing impactful content to effectively amplify our messages to internal and external audiences. Reporting to the India Communications Manager, you will be responsible for helping us shape our narrative, inspire our workforce, bring our brand to life and shape perceptions with key audiences.


This position requires strong cross-team collaboration across multiple functions and close partnership with corporate communications teammates across Asia and in the US.


Primary Responsibilities

1. Graphic Design & Content Creation

  • Deliver to graphic design requirements across all communications touchpoints in India.
  • Develop content suitable for various internal & external target audiences e.g. newsletters, mailers, posters, intranet
  • Ownership of creating and managing a robust content repository, with process for long-term management
  • Oversee compliance to brand guidelines in general communication

2. Internal Communications

  • Support an annual calendar of events at the office with campaigns and communications.
  • Execute programs that help regional leaders align and engage employees to achieve the desired business outcomes.
  • Creation of mailers, posters, and other collateral on a need basis.
  • Own and manage the company intranet with engaging stories.
  • Coordinate with multiple stakeholders across levels leadership/location SPOCs/tech experts, departments.

3. Social Media

  • Create/review social media posts for the company as necessary, manage internal social media channels as necessary
  • Creative ideas for stories and campaigns

4. Event Management Support

  • Work with key India stakeholders in India to conceive and run effective employee engagement programs.
  • Part of ideation, planning and execution internal & external events
  • Coordination with multiple internal stakeholders and vendors

5. Social Impact

  • Campaigns around employee volunteering/employee giving
  • Social impact storytelling - internal & external channels
  • Coordination with the Social Impact groups/committees in the company

6. General Departmental

  • Drive continuous improvement for our communications activities
  • Research and analytics to on trends and various relevant topics
  • Administrative tasks pertaining to Communications

Preferred Qualifications & Experience

  • Bachelors degree in graphic design communications, journalism, public affairs, or related fields.
  • Experienced leading projects or initiatives with multiple stakeholders across functions and countries with a proven record of meeting objectives on time and on budget.
  • Ability to demonstrate critical thinking skills, challenge the status quo, and recommend unique approaches to achieve the desired outcomes.
  • A passion for engaging in new and innovative communication methods to drive breakthrough audience experiences.
  • 2-5years of work experience in similar roles preferred.

Demonstrated skills required for performing the job

  • Excellent communication skills
  • Graphic design skills
  • Ability to write and edit effective content.
  • Ability to act with urgency to juggle multiple projects without significant oversight and follow through to their impactful execution.
  • Strong team spirit, positive outlook, and sense of humor
  • Maturity and ability to build/nurture effective work relationships while working in a team environment with peers and seniors, senior leadership, multi-ethnic groups, genders and matrix org structure

Job Classification

Industry: Electronic Components / Semiconductors
Functional Area / Department: Marketing & Communication
Role Category: Corporate Communication
Role: Corporate Communication - Other
Employement Type: Full time

Contact Details:

Company: RGBSI Hiring
Location(s): Bengaluru

+ View Contactajax loader


Keyskills:   Content Creation Public Relations Media Relations Corporate Communication Brand Communication Event Management

 Job seems aged, it may have been expired!
 Fraud Alert to job seekers!

₹ Not Disclosed

Similar positions

Senior Marketing Operations Specialist (Channel Marketing)

  • Sophos
  • 5 - 10 years
  • Remote
  • 2 mths ago
₹ Not Disclosed

Associate - Marketing Communications ( Presentations)

  • Ameriprise Financial
  • 1 - 3 years
  • Noida, Gurugram
  • 2 mths ago
₹ Not Disclosed

Sr. Internal Communications Lead

  • Avalara Technologies
  • 8 - 13 years
  • Pune
  • 3 mths ago
₹ Not Disclosed

RGBSI

At RGBSI, we deliver engineering and quality solutions that close the gap between strategy and execution for global organizations of all sizes. Through in-house developed intellectual properties and cutting-edge technologies, we help clients enhance performance and adopt innovation. Our portfolio sp...